oRPC Patterns
Use this when adding or refactoring oRPC procedures, routers, or client integration in this repo.

Server Route Shape
Define routes with the shared procedure factories from packages/api/src/lib/procedures/factory.ts.
- Use
publicProcedurefor public read operations. - Use
protectedProcedurefor authenticated operations. - Add route metadata with
.route({ description, method }). - Define
input(...)andoutput(...)schemas explicitly with Zod. - Prefer returning repo-native shapes directly instead of renaming fields unless there is a strong product reason.
Typical shape:
const exampleInputSchema = z.object({
id: z.string().min(1)
});
const exampleOutputSchema = z.object({
id: z.string(),
name: z.string()
});
export const exampleRouter = {
byId: publicProcedure
.route({
description: "Get an example by ID",
method: "GET"
})
.input(exampleInputSchema)
.output(exampleOutputSchema.nullable())
.handler(async ({ input, context, errors }) => {
// ...
})
};Errors
Prefer type-safe oRPC errors with .errors(...) on the procedure base.
- Define expected errors up front.
- Use
errors.MY_ERROR()in handlers. - Use
dataschemas only for fields the client truly needs, and never include sensitive information. - Reserve thrown unknown errors for truly unexpected cases.
- Do not leak sensitive information through error data or messages.
ORPCErroris still valid when you need interoperability, but prefer.errors(...)so the client can infer and narrow error types.
Example:
const protectedExampleProcedure = protectedProcedure.errors({
RATE_LIMITED: {
data: z.object({
retryAfter: z.number().int().min(1)
}),
status: 429
},
DATABASE_ERROR: {
description: "Failed to update example",
status: 500
},
EXAMPLE_NOT_FOUND: {
message: "Example not found",
status: 404
}
});Equivalent ORPCError throws are fine when the code, status, and data match a defined error, but the repo default should still be the typed errors.*(...) form.
Logging
oRPC handlers receive the request-scoped logger as context.logger.
- Follow Logging patterns for event shape, emit lifecycle, redaction, and global error handling.
- Do not add durable procedure logs unless logging was explicitly requested or the flow is audit, security, or otherwise high-risk.
- Reuse
context.logger; do not create a standalone logger inside a procedure. - If extra context is needed for an unexpected failure, attach it with
logger.set(...)and let shared error handling record the failure once. - Do not log routine reads or duplicate middleware and global error logging.
When a handler genuinely needs a durable outcome log, use one wide terminal event:
.handler(async ({ context, input, errors }) => {
const logger = context.logger;
logger.set({
procedure: "profile.edit",
profile: { id: context.session.user.id },
});
const row = await updateProfile(input);
if (!row) {
throw errors.PROFILE_NOT_FOUND();
}
logger.emit({
event: "profile_edit_completed",
profile: { id: row.id },
});
return row;
})Router Conventions
- Group related procedures in a slice router, for example
profileRouter. - Prefer straightforward names like
byId,search,edit,create,remove. - Keep DB access close to the handler unless reuse clearly justifies extraction.
- If extraction is justified but the logic is still slice-local, colocate it beside the router in sibling files such as
queries.tsorutils.ts. Do not push one-off router helpers intopackages/api/src/lib/by default. - Convert server-only values to transport-safe output values at the edge, for example
Date→ ISO string. - Keep handler logic linear and shallow. If the flow grows, extract helpers.
Router Folder Shape
The default slice-local router shape is:
packages/api/src/routers/<slice>/
index.ts
queries.tsUse sibling files for helpers that are only used by that router.
index.tsowns the public router definition.queries.tsowns slice-local DB readers, aggregations, transport shaping helpers, and similar reusable helpers for that router.utils.tsorconstants.tsare fine when the helper is still router-local and not shared elsewhere.- Promote code into
packages/api/src/lib/only when it is reused across multiple routers or is truly infrastructure-level.
Shared Contracts
When an oRPC input or output schema represents a shared domain contract, source it from packages/core instead of redefining it locally.
- Follow Core package patterns for shared enums, filters, categories, transport-safe shapes, and defaults consumed outside one router.
- Keep router-local helper queries and transport-only shapes next to the router.
- Keep cross-router or infrastructure helpers in
lib/only when that reuse is real.
Client Error Handling
Follow API fetching patterns for query and mutation file structure.
- Prefer type-safe client error handling for oRPC-backed mutations and user-visible failure states.
- Import
isDefinedErrorfrom@orpc/clientwhen narrowing mutation or action errors. - Prefer oRPC's built-in client helpers over custom error-guard utilities when the library already provides the needed narrowing.
- Switch on
error.codeinstead of string-matchingmessagetext. - Read
error.dataonly for errors that define typed data in.errors(...). - If AI generates generic
instanceof Errorhandling for defined server errors, steer it back to the typedisDefinedError(error)branch.
Example:
import { isDefinedError } from "@orpc/client";
import { useMutation } from "@tanstack/react-query";
import { toast } from "sonner";
import { type client, orpc } from "@saasweave/api/client/tanstack-start/orpc";
export function getEditProfileMutationOptions() {
return orpc.profile.edit.mutationOptions({
onError: (error) => {
if (isDefinedError(error)) {
switch (error.code) {
case "PROFILE_NOT_FOUND":
toast.error(error.message ?? "Profile not found.");
return;
case "RATE_LIMITED":
toast.error(`Try again in ${error.data.retryAfter} seconds.`);
return;
case "DATABASE_ERROR":
toast.error(error.message ?? "Failed to update profile.");
return;
}
}
toast.error(error instanceof Error ? error.message : "Failed to update profile.");
}
});
}
export function useEditProfileMutation() {
return useMutation(getEditProfileMutationOptions());
}
export type EditProfileMutationResult = Awaited<ReturnType<typeof client.profile.edit>>;Practical Rules
- Prefer explicit
inputandoutputschemas on every procedure. - Prefer typed oRPC errors over ad hoc string matching.
- Prefer
.errors(...)pluserrors.MY_ERROR(...)over rawnew ORPCError(...)unless interoperability or framework glue makes the raw form clearer. - Prefer
isDefinedError(error)pluserror.code/error.datafor client-side branching. - Prefer sparse, request-scoped wide events over ad hoc per-step logs.
- Prefer shared error handling over log-and-rethrow patterns in handlers.
- Prefer API fetching patterns for slice-local query and mutation wrappers, preloading, and cache invalidation.
